Climate change and poverty top the agenda
Politicians and researchers agree that a number of problems need to be given priority. Poverty and climate change are high on the UN's agenda.

Climate change is not just about tsunamis in Asia or tornadoes in the US. It can equally well be about new diseases that could spread to Denmark, crops that can no longer be grown, or non-native animal species out-competing endangered native species.

Your neighbourhood too
Poverty is not just a matter of famine in Africa or slums in the Philippines. It can equally well be about homeless people and the seriously ill in your local area – maybe even where your company operates.
